#b16fb5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b16fb5 is composed of 69.4% red, 43.5% green and 71%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 2.2% cyan, 38.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 296.6 degrees, a saturation of 32.1% and a lightness of 57.3%. #b16fb5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ffdeff with #63006b. Closest websafe color is: #9966cc.

Shades and Tints of #b16fb5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b060b is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#b16fb5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#939193 is the less saturated color, while #ec2cf8 is the most saturated one.
